This bracelet isn’t just shaped like a bar—it’s named after the iconic 12-bar blues progression that’s the backbone of countless legendary tracks. The cymbal piece is mostly black, with flashes of bronze breaking through like a killer guitar solo. Each one hits a different note, so yours may look quite different from what’s pictured—but that’s part of the charm.
Cymbal piece measures approximately 1.25" x 0.5". Adjustable black cord with button-style closure fits wrists up to 9 inches.
Made from reclaimed bronze cymbals. Each piece carries its own story and imperfections—just like the blues.

About Full Circle Co.
Full Circle Co. started in the summer of 2018 when Liz Aponte had a thought: What can I do with my broken cymbals? Her cymbals helped her learn different beats, toured the country with her, and even helped her teach other people drums. So when she would break cymbals, she was devastated.
After a year of research and development, countless tweaks and making sure they could actually take bashed material and make it beautiful, Full Circle Co. was born. The name Full Circle comes from the fact that a cymbal is a circle, but also from the material they use coming full circle.
Each product from Full Circle Co. has a past history that spans years, from the transformation of metal to a usable cymbal, then to the owner of that cymbal using it to further their musical passion, and now into your hands to carry on that legacy.
All Full Circle Co. jewelry is made in Salt Lake City, Utah.
